🤝 Share a line that introduces a character.
Digging some personal stuff out, but here’s Sentenza’s introduction from my original novel:
The other man, who has been hanging behind Nia, now steps forward to study the body— tilting his head. His cheekbones are so sunken she could nearly map his skull just by observing him. It's then she notices his left eye is made of glass.
He catches her gaze just as she has this realization, the narrowing of his right eye giving her a strange reassurance. She looks away, seeking out her notebook to make a sketch of the marks on the corpse’s neck.
